What is The Diamond Restaurant known for?

Hipster-friendly Greek diner serves a vast comfort-food menu with Greek, Italian & Southern accents.

Customers generally enjoy the classic diner feel, friendly service, and solid comfort food.

Cynthia R4.0· 2 years ago2024-01-17

Nothing like an old school restaurant to visit in a city that’s being saturated by breweries and pizza joints. I got the salmon BLT, it was good but wasn’t the best I’ve ever had. The menu is pretty simple, burgers, dogs and other sandwiches. I’d definitely go back and try more items. I went at lunch time around 1:30 and it was just a few more people inside. The place doesn’t have a whole lot of seats so thankfully there was no lunch rush I ran into. They do have some patio seating that will be awesome when weather is warm. I chose to sit at the bar and was served immediately. Young lady who was my waitress was awesome. Very sweet and attentive without being overbearing.
